This article explores comprehensive strategies for leveraging Google SGE in educational contexts, focusing on how AI-powered conversations can tailor knowledge acquisition to individual needs.<\/p>\n<h2>Understanding Google SGE Conversational Search<\/h2>\n<p>Google SGE is an experimental feature that applies generative AI to search results, allowing users to ask complex questions and receive conversational, synthesized answers rather than a list of links. Unlike traditional search, SGE can handle multi-step queries, clarify intent, and generate responses in a natural dialogue format. For education, this means students can explore topics through follow-up questions, receive explanations tailored to their comprehension level, and even request examples or analogies. The underlying model understands context and can adjust its responses based on previous interactions, making it a powerful tool for personalized learning.<\/p>\n<h3>Core Features of Google SGE in Education<\/h3>\n<p>SGE offers several features that directly benefit educational environments:<\/p>\n<ul>\n<li>Conversational follow-ups: Students can ask &#8220;Explain further&#8221; or &#8220;Give me an example&#8221; without restarting the search.<\/li>\n<li>Multimodal outputs: Responses may include text, images, and links to relevant sources, enriching the learning experience.<\/li>\n<li>Source attribution: SGE cites sources, enabling learners to verify information and dive deeper into original materials.<\/li>\n<li>Adaptive complexity: The AI can adjust the depth of explanation based on the user&#8217;s apparent knowledge level, inferred from query phrasing.<\/li>\n<\/ul>\n<h2>Key Strategies for Implementing SGE in Educational Workflows<\/h2>\n<p>To maximize the educational impact of Google SGE, educators and institutions should adopt specific conversational search strategies that align with pedagogical goals. These strategies leverage SGE&#8217;s ability to provide instant, context-aware responses while maintaining academic rigor.<\/p>\n<h3>Strategy 1: Scaffolded Inquiry-Based Learning<\/h3>\n<p>Design assignments that encourage students to use SGE for scaffolded exploration. For example, a teacher might ask students to start with a broad question like &#8220;What caused the Industrial Revolution?&#8221; then use follow-up prompts such as &#8220;Compare economic factors in Britain vs. France&#8221; or &#8220;Explain the role of steam power.&#8221; SGE&#8217;s conversational nature helps students break complex topics into manageable chunks, promoting deeper understanding.<\/p>\n<h3>Strategy 2: Personalized Remediation and Enrichment<\/h3>\n<p>Struggling students can ask SGE to rephrase explanations in simpler terms or provide step-by-step solutions to math problems. Advanced learners can request challenging extensions or interdisciplinary connections. By training students to formulate specific queries, educators enable self-paced learning that caters to individual proficiency levels.<\/p>\n<h3>Strategy 3: Real-Time Fact-Checking and Source Verification<\/h3>\n<p>SGE includes source citations, making it a valuable tool for teaching information literacy. Students can be instructed to cross-reference AI-generated summaries with original sources, learning to evaluate credibility. A strategy might involve asking SGE to summarize a historical event, then requiring students to find and compare the cited articles.<\/p>\n<h2>Practical Applications: How Educators and Students Use SGE<\/h2>\n<p>The versatility of Google SGE allows it to be integrated into various educational settings, from K-12 classrooms to higher education and professional training. Below are specific application scenarios.<\/p>\n<h3>In the Classroom: Interactive Lectures and Assignments<\/h3>\n<p>A teacher conducting a lesson on climate change can use SGE as an interactive assistant. During the lecture, students can pose real-time questions like &#8220;What are the main sources of carbon emissions in developing countries?&#8221; and SGE provides instant, conversational answers. The teacher can then discuss the AI&#8217;s response, highlighting its strengths and limitations. For assignments, students can create dialogue logs showing their question chain and how SGE helped them arrive at conclusions.<\/p>\n<h3>For Self-Study and Homework Support<\/h3>\n<p>Students studying independently can use SGE to overcome learning obstacles. For instance, a student struggling with calculus can ask &#8220;Explain the chain rule with a simple analogy&#8221; and then request &#8220;Show me a worked example with trigonometric functions.&#8221; The conversational flow mimics a tutor, offering multiple explanations until the concept clicks.<\/p>\n<h3>In Higher Education Research<\/h3>\n<p>Graduate students can use SGE to rapidly explore literature reviews. Instead of keyword searches, they can ask complex research questions like &#8220;What are the latest findings on quantum entanglement in condensed matter physics?&#8221; SGE synthesizes information from multiple sources, providing a starting point for deeper investigation. Researchers can then follow up with specific source requests.<\/p>\n<h2>Future Outlook: Personalized Learning at Scale with SGE<\/h2>\n<p>As Google continues to refine SGE, its educational applications will expand.
